In 1948, Louis-Ferdinand Céline was accused by the French courts to have collaborated with the Nazis and was exiled in Denmark with his wife, Lucette. Milton Hindus, a young American Jewish writer who admires and supports him fervently joins in the depths of the Danish countryside, with the intention to write a memoir about their meeting.
